I had my wedding last weekend, and the venue's AC kicked on right as we were doing our vows, totally making it impossible to hear what we were saying (recorded on my brothers iphone 15 pro max)... but i got my pixel 8 pro the next day, and the audio eraser 100% saved the video almost completely cutting out the ac noise and saving the video. The audio magic eraser (all though not perfect) literally saved a once in a life time video.

Reviewers keep saying about the over HDR in Pixel 8 shots, yes it brightens shadows by default as that is the safer option, but if you like the shadows to be darker in any image literally one tap on the brightest thing in the photo and the Pixel will instantly amend the exposure and you get that more "moody" shot you want. It's a non-issue
Is that "one tap" within the camera shot or is it in postproduction?
@@flyingaviator8158 during camera shot
@@flyingaviator8158within the shot. Do the inverse of what they said to make it bright(er)

I see a lot of comments talking about about Nokia having a feature like this but it seems the world forgot that in 2012 Blackberry introduced a similar feature on their BB OS 10 called Time Shift.

I feel like the Magic Eraser and Magic Editor are just bringing Photoshop to the masses. The "content aware fill" brush has been available in Photoshop for years at this point, Google just used AI to make it better and put it on a phone.

David's point about the storage and gating into a ecosystem is spot on and very well observed! In B2B used do that for a while now under the term of Data Gravity, and then it was a real thing in terms of pain points, and by now has morphed into an easy margin source for providers. Bringing this sales strategy to end consumers is only logical. Margins on storage nowadays are insane, and the cost of moving is always with the end user. Well spotted David!
